The decision is made early today, and many people busy themselves with food gathering from the garden, though several watch Airhog's drunken antics and poetry during the day. At the end of the day everyone gathers to get ready for the inevitable with Airhog. As people surround him, he stands up and launches into a drunken speech about how he can't be a werewolf, and how he has proof. He reveals his noble medallion and papers that reveal him as the Duke! The mob grudgingly agrees that he is indeed who he says he is, and when Airhog points towards TazFTW, everyone quickly turns towards him. Taz's eyes go wide as he realizes what's going on, and he starts stammering "But I'm...I'm not..." until there is the loud pop of a pistol shot and the stink of gunpowder smoke fills the air. Taz's body collapses near the fireplace, shot in the head. Unfortunately, TazFTW was an innocent villager.

Well basic math would give them a reason to go after airhog. Right now there are 17 of us left and we presumably aren't going to vote to lynch Airhog. Therefore, we have a 1/16 of voting for a werewolf as of this moment. If they eat someone besides Airhog that chance drops down to 1/15 chance of lynching a werewolf. However, if they eat Airhog we will still only have 1/16 chance of getting them. It's not a HUGE difference, but there is a statistical advantage to them going after Airhog. Of course, the bodyguards could protect him in which case it would be a wasted attack. It will be very interesting to see what the Werewolves do.
